Based on the latest financial reports, Leonardo DRS, Inc. Common Stock (DRS) has net assets worth $2.77 Billion USD as of March 2026. Net assets (also known as shareholders' equity or book value) represent the difference between a company's total assets ($4.21 Billion) and total liabilities ($1.44 Billion). This figure indicates the residual interest in the assets after deducting liabilities, essentially showing what would remain for shareholders if all assets were liquidated and all debts paid off. Equity Growth Attribution

This analysis shows how different factors contributed to changes in Leonardo DRS, Inc. Common Stock's equity between the two most recent reporting periods.

Equity Growth Insights

  • From 2024 to 2025, total equity changed from 2,557,000,000 to 2,730,000,000, a change of 173,000,000 (6.8%).
  • Net income of 278,000,000 contributed positively to equity growth.
  • Dividend payments of 96,000,000 reduced retained earnings.
  • Share repurchases of 35,000,000 reduced equity.
  • New share issuances of 9,000,000 increased equity.
  • Other comprehensive income increased equity by 6,000,000.

Leonardo DRS, Inc., together with its subsidiaries, provides defense electronic products and systems, and military support services worldwide. It operates through Advanced Sensing and Computing and Integrated Mission Systems segments.
